## Ownership

The clock-skew monitor for the Quarrylight build farm lives in this repo. Build agents occasionally drift more than the 250ms tolerance, which breaks artifact timestamp ordering and causes the Slatebird scheduler to mark runs as flaky. If support sees skew alerts, first check the NTP sidecar logs, then escalate rather than restarting agents manually — restarts mask the drift without fixing it. Questions about the monitor, its thresholds, or the escalation path go to the component owner listed below.

account owner for kagag-yahap: Novath Quenok

## WaveScope Environments

WaveScope renders audio waveform previews for uploads in the Tonari media library. Three environments exist: dev, staging, and prod. Each runs an isolated renderer pool with no cross-environment network access. Staging mirrors prod sizing to keep render latency benchmarks honest. Access to prod is gated through the Brimfell bastion. The staging environment currently uses the following configuration values.

deployment values, kajep-kageg:
[praix]
host = praix.paliqcorp.corp
user = praix_svc
database = praix_prod

Management Meeting Minutes — Project Oakmire Delay

Present: all department heads. Gerrit Falswood confirmed Oakmire is six weeks late due to testing failures at the Brindlemoor facility. Actions: Procurement to renegotiate the Quellan contract; Engineering to deliver a recovery plan by Friday; Comms to brief staff after sign-off. Next review in two weeks. The chair closed with a confidential remark, recorded below for heads only.

internal memo for yahag-hahig: Belwynix Group plans to lower the Silir list price by 62 percent in May.

## 2.8.0 — Changed defaults

Chirprelay, our deploy-status chat bot, now posts rollout updates to per-team channels by default instead of the global feed, reducing noise flagged in the last retro. Mention-on-failure is now enabled out of the box, and the polling interval was tightened from 60s to 20s. Release managers should verify channel mappings before promoting this build. The revised default configuration is shown below.

settings of fafog-haduf:
ZORIX_PIN=4648
ZORIX_METRICS_HOST=metrics.zorix.paliqsys.corp
ZORIX_LOG_LEVEL=info
ZORIX_TENANT=druix